Market Overview

MARKET INSIGHTS

The global dermal substitutes market was valued at USD 1.5 billion in 2023 and is projected to reach USD 4.04 billion by 2030, exhibiting a compound annual growth rate (CAGR) of 16.4% during the forecast period. This growth is primarily driven by the rising incidence of chronic wounds, increasing diabetic population, and growing adoption of advanced wound care technologies.

Dermal substitutes are specialized bio-matrices designed to replicate the functions of the native dermal layer. They serve as temporary or permanent scaffolds that promote tissue regeneration, reduce scarring, and improve wound healing outcomes. These advanced wound care solutions are categorized into synthetic, biosynthetic, and biological substitutes based on their composition and origin.

The market expansion is fueled by several key factors. The global burden of chronic wounds continues to rise, with approximately 2.5 million patients suffering from chronic wounds annually in the U.S. alone. Concurrently, the diabetic population is increasing globally, projected to reach 700 million by 2045, creating substantial demand for advanced wound care solutions. Technological advancements in biomaterial science have enabled development of next-generation dermal substitutes with enhanced biocompatibility and integration capabilities. The recent approval of novel products such as Integra LifeSciences' Integra Omnigraft Dermal Regeneration Template and Smith & Nephew's REGEN-Dermal substitute has further stimulated market growth.

Market analysis indicates that North America currently dominates the dermal substitutes market with approximately 45% market share, followed by Europe with 30% market share. The Asia-Pacific region is expected to witness the highest growth rate (18.2% CAGR) during the forecast period, driven by improving healthcare infrastructure and increasing healthcare expenditure.

Key players in the market include Integra LifeSciences, Smith & Nephew, Organogenesis, Allergan, and MiMedx, among others. These companies are focusing on strategic collaborations, product launches, and geographical expansion to strengthen their market position. For instance, in 2023, Integra LifeSciences announced a strategic partnership with a leading tissue regeneration company to enhance their product portfolio.

MARKET DRIVERS

Rising Prevalence of Chronic Wounds

With the global increase in diabetes and vascular diseases, the incidence of chronic wounds like diabetic ulcers has surged significantly. This creates sustained demand for advanced wound care solutions including dermal substitutes that accelerate healing in complex wound scenarios.

Advancements in Regenerative Medicine

The field of regenerative medicine has made substantial progress in developing biologically active dermal substitutes that not only provide temporary coverage but actively stimulate the body's own healing mechanisms. These advanced products integrate with host tissue more effectively than previous generations.

The global dermal substitutes market is projected to reach $5.8 billion by 2028, growing at a CAGR of 11.3%, driven by these technological advancements and increasing clinical adoption.

Healthcare systems globally are increasing their investment in advanced wound care as they recognize the long-term cost savings of preventing chronic wound complications. This shift from reactive to preventive care models significantly drives adoption of dermal substitutes.

MARKET CHALLENGES

High Product Costs and Reimbursement Limitations

Advanced dermal substitutes represent significant investments for healthcare providers, with some products costing thousands of dollars per application. This creates adoption barriers particularly in emerging markets and regions with constrained healthcare budgets. Reimbursement policies often lag behind technological innovation, creating financial disincentives for both providers and patients.

Other Challenges

Regulatory Hurdles and Standardization Issues
The regulatory pathway for dermal substitutes varies significantly across different regions, with some markets requiring extensive clinical data that can take years to accumulate. This creates market entry barriers for new entrants. Additionally, the lack of standardized outcome measures makes comparative effectiveness research challenging.

MARKET RESTRAINTS

Limited Surgeon Training and Experience

Despite the availability of advanced dermal substitutes, optimal outcomes depend heavily on proper application technique and case selection. There remains a significant learning curve for many surgeons, particularly in regions where these technologies have only recently become available. This limits adoption rates even where products are accessible.

MARKET OPPORTUNITIES

Emerging Markets and Untapped Potential

While North America and Europe currently dominate the dermal substitutes market, the Asia-Pacific region represents the fastest growing market with projected growth rates exceeding 15% annually. Rising healthcare expenditure, increasing medical tourism, and growing awareness of advanced wound care options create substantial opportunities. Countries like China, India, and Brazil are developing their own manufacturing capabilities, reducing costs and increasing accessibility.

Specialized dermal substitutes for specific wound types represent another major opportunity. The development of products specifically designed for burn injuries versus chronic wounds versus acute trauma allows for optimized outcomes. Additionally, the integration of dermal substitutes with other advanced therapies like stem cell technology creates new market segments with premium pricing potential.

Segment Analysis:
Segment Category Sub-Segments Key Insights
By Type
  • Biological
  • Biosynthetic
  • Synthetic
Biological substitutes are generally recognized as the dominant category due to their superior biocompatibility and ability to mimic the natural extracellular matrix, which promotes superior tissue integration and regeneration. This segment benefits from a strong clinical history in treating complex wounds. The market is concurrently witnessing a significant innovation drive within the Biosynthetic segment, where new materials combining biological and synthetic components are emerging, offering enhanced control over degradation rates and mechanical properties, indicating a promising future direction for product development.
By Application
  • Chronic Wounds
  • Acute Wounds
  • Aesthetic & Reconstructive Surgery
  • Burn Care
Chronic Wounds represent the most significant application area, driven by the growing global prevalence of conditions like diabetic foot ulcers and venous leg ulcers that require advanced healing solutions. The substantial clinical and economic burden associated with managing these non-healing wounds creates a persistent and expanding demand for effective dermal substitutes. Furthermore, the Aesthetic & Reconstructive Surgery segment is experiencing rapid growth, fueled by increasing consumer demand for cosmetic procedures and the expanding use of these products in post-surgical reconstruction to improve functional and cosmetic outcomes.
By End User
  • Hospitals
  • Wound Care Centers
  • Ambulatory Surgery Centers
Hospitals are the primary end-users, as they possess the necessary infrastructure, surgical expertise, and patient volume for complex procedures involving dermal substitutes, especially for severe burns and traumatic injuries. However, Wound Care Centers are emerging as a critically important segment, specializing in the long-term management of chronic wounds and creating a focused, high-demand environment for these advanced therapies. The shift towards outpatient care is also bolstering the role of Ambulatory Surgery Centers, which offer cost-effective settings for elective reconstructive and aesthetic procedures.
By Material Origin
  • Human-Derived (Allograft, Xenograft)
  • Animal-Derived
  • Fully Synthetic
Human-Derived materials, particularly allografts, are often preferred for their high biocompatibility and reduced risk of immune rejection, making them a leading choice for many clinicians. Nonetheless, supply limitations and regulatory hurdles present ongoing challenges. The Fully Synthetic segment is gaining considerable traction due to its advantages of unlimited scalability, consistent quality, and elimination of disease transmission concerns, positioning it as a key area for future market expansion and technological innovation aimed at improving bio-integration.
By Product Form
  • Sheet/Matrix Form
  • Powder/Injectable Form
  • Combination Products
Sheet/Matrix Form products are the dominant format, widely used for their ease of handling and application in surgical settings for covering large wound areas. They provide a stable scaffold for cellular infiltration. The Powder/Injectable Form segment is witnessing accelerated growth, driven by the demand for minimally invasive procedures and the ability to fill irregularly shaped wounds, which enhances treatment versatility. The development of Combination Products that incorporate growth factors or antimicrobial agents represents a significant trend, aiming to create next-generation substitutes with augmented healing capabilities.

Regional Analysis: Dermal Substitutes Market
North America
North America maintains its dominance in the global dermal substitutes market, driven by a highly advanced healthcare infrastructure. The United States is the primary contributor, with widespread adoption of these advanced wound care solutions in hospitals and specialized burn centers. A strong presence of leading medical device companies, robust research and development activities, and favorable reimbursement policies from both private and public payers significantly fuel market growth. High patient awareness regarding the benefits of advanced wound healing, coupled with a well-established regulatory framework from the Food and Drug Administration (FDA) that facilitates product approvals, creates a conducive environment. The region also sees a high incidence of chronic wounds, such as diabetic ulcers and venous leg ulcers, which necessitates the use of sophisticated dermal regeneration templates. Continuous technological advancements and a strong focus on improving patient outcomes through innovative biologic and synthetic substitutes further consolidate North America's leading position.
Advanced Healthcare Ecosystem
The region's sophisticated healthcare network, including top-tier academic medical centers and specialized clinics, readily adopts and integrates advanced dermal substitutes. This ecosystem supports extensive clinical training for surgeons and promotes best practices in complex wound management, ensuring high utilization rates for products ranging from acellular matrices to composite skin substitutes.
Innovation and R&D Leadership
North America is a hub for biomedical innovation, with significant investments in research focused on developing next-generation dermal substitutes. Collaborations between universities, research institutes, and industry players lead to the creation of products with enhanced biocompatibility, improved integration, and better aesthetic outcomes, keeping the region at the forefront of technological progress.
Favorable Reimbursement Landscape
Comprehensive insurance coverage and clear reimbursement pathways for advanced wound care procedures are critical drivers. Medicare and private insurers in the US provide coverage for many dermal substitute applications, such as treating diabetic foot ulcers, which reduces out-of-pocket costs for patients and encourages broader adoption by healthcare providers.
High Clinical Demand
A growing prevalence of conditions requiring skin regeneration, including severe burns, traumatic injuries, and complex surgical wounds, sustains strong demand. An aging population more susceptible to chronic wounds further amplifies this need, ensuring a consistent and expanding patient base for dermal substitute therapies across the region.

Europe
Europe represents a mature and significant market for dermal substitutes, characterized by stringent regulatory oversight via the MDR and a strong emphasis on cost-effective healthcare. Countries like Germany, France, and the United Kingdom are key contributors, with well-established wound care protocols in their national health systems. The market benefits from high healthcare spending and a growing focus on improving patient quality of life post-surgery or trauma. There is increasing adoption of biologic substitutes, driven by a preference for materials that promote natural tissue regeneration. However, market growth is somewhat tempered by budget constraints within public healthcare systems and the rigorous clinical evidence required for product approvals and reimbursement decisions.

Asia-Pacific
The Asia-Pacific region is experiencing the most rapid growth in the dermal substitutes market, fueled by improving healthcare infrastructure, rising medical tourism, and increasing healthcare expenditure. Countries such as Japan, China, and India are witnessing a surge in demand due to a growing incidence of burns and chronic wounds, alongside a rising awareness of advanced treatment options. Expanding access to healthcare in emerging economies and the growing presence of multinational companies introducing their products are key dynamics. Local manufacturing initiatives are also beginning to reduce costs and improve availability. Despite this growth, challenges remain, including varying reimbursement scenarios and the need for greater training among healthcare professionals in the use of these advanced biologics.

South America
The South American market for dermal substitutes is in a developing phase, with Brazil and Argentina being the primary markets. Growth is driven by gradual improvements in public and private healthcare services and an increasing number of cosmetic and reconstructive surgeries. Economic volatility and disparities in healthcare access between urban and rural areas pose significant challenges. The adoption of advanced wound care technologies is often concentrated in major metropolitan hospitals. Market expansion is contingent on economic stability, increased healthcare investment, and greater educational efforts to demonstrate the clinical and economic benefits of dermal substitutes over traditional wound management techniques.

Middle East & Africa
The Middle East & Africa region shows a varied landscape for dermal substitutes. Wealthier Gulf Cooperation Council (GCC) countries, such as Saudi Arabia and the UAE, have modern healthcare systems that adopt advanced technologies, supported by high government healthcare spending and medical tourism initiatives. In contrast, many parts of Africa face significant challenges, including limited healthcare infrastructure and access to advanced treatments. The overall market potential is growing, particularly in the Middle East, driven by an increasing focus on specialized medical care, a rising burden of diabetes-related wounds, and investments in building specialized burn and trauma centers, though affordability remains a key barrier across the broader region.
